Method
Preparation of the Base
- 1
Mix the Base Ingredients
In a medium bowl, combine the goat cheese and cream cheese. Use a fork or a hand mixer to blend until smooth and creamy.
- 2
Add Heavy Cream
Slowly add the heavy cream to the cheese mixture, mixing until fully incorporated and the mixture is light and airy.
- 3
Season the Mixture
Add the chopped fresh herbs, salt, and black pepper to the mixture. Stir until evenly distributed.
Layering the Terrine
- 4
Prepare the Terrine Dish
Line a terrine mold or a loaf pan with plastic wrap, leaving enough overhang to cover the top later.
- 5
Add the First Layer
Spoon half of the goat cheese mixture into the prepared mold, smoothing it out evenly.
- 6
Layer with Vegetables
Add a layer of chopped roasted red peppers over the goat cheese mixture, spreading them evenly.
- 7
Add the Second Layer
Spread the remaining goat cheese mixture on top of the roasted red peppers, smoothing it out.
- 8
Final Layer
Top with the chopped olives and walnuts, pressing them slightly into the cheese mixture.
Chilling the Terrine
- 9
Cover and Chill
Fold the plastic wrap over the top of the terrine and place it in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, or overnight for best results.
